Reuse, Reduce, Recycle at First Pres
First Pres collects the following items for the indicated organizations. Collection containers are located in the Collection Center outside the office. These items make a difference!
Ink Cartridges redeem at $3.00 each and supplement the Pastor's emergency fund. $60.00 was contributed to this fund through redemption in 2012. The following brands/models are included in the program:
Lexmark: 1, 2, 3, 16, 17, 20, 26, 27, 32, 33, 34, 35, 60, 80, 82, 83
HP: 17, 21, 22, 28, 57, 74/74XL, 75/75XL, 901/XL black, 60 black, 60 color
Canon: CK-31, CK-41, CL-51, CL-211/XL, PG-30, PG-40, PG-50, PG-210/XL
Dell: All except Series 7, 11, and 20
Education Box Tops and Campbell Soup Labels are contributed to Tekoppel School where they are redeemeds for a wide variety of school related equipment for the classrooms and playground.
Aluminum Tabs from aluminum cans are contributed to the Ronald McDonald House for redemption.
Cell Phones, old, outdated, or even broken are sold and 100% of the proceeds are donated to TOUCH, which provides non-medical financial assistance to cancer patients. TOUCH = Transportation, Out-of-pocket expenses, Utilities, Children's Resources, Housing.
Eye Glasses reuse is a project of the Lions Club
Travel-sized Toiletries are donated to United Caring Shelter for its 100 male residents and transitional housing for 23 men.
Hearing Aids are donated to the Ohio Valley Presbytery where they are reused by International Center of Bethlehem
Belts and Bras, gently used, are needed by the PTA Clothing Bank.
